Vai al contenuto principale

Elimina dal cloud

Struttura

DeleteFromCloud(sService, sFileName, sFolder: String; bAllowAuth: Boolean): String

Tipo

Funzione

Descrizione

Questa funzione elimina un nome di file (sFileName) dal servizio cloud specificato da sService. Se il file si trova in una sottocartella del servizio cloud, è possibile specificarlo nel parametro sFolder. All'esecuzione, se non esiste alcun token per il servizio cloud E il parametro bAuth è impostato su True, verrà visualizzata la schermata di accesso al servizio in una finestra del browser. Questo token verrà memorizzato per le sessioni future. La funzione restituirà "SUCCESS" se l'operazione di eliminazione va a buon fine.

Parametri: 4

sService = il nome del servizio cloud online. I valori ammessi sono: 'BOX' (box.com) e 'DROPBOX' (dropbox.com)

sFileName = il nome del file da eliminare

sFolder = nome facoltativo della cartella in cui si trova il file. Questa cartella deve trovarsi a un solo livello di profondità, direttamente sotto la directory principale.

bAllowAuth = Se i token precedentemente salvati nel database non vengono trovati e/o non consentono l'accesso al servizio online, questo parametro determina se deve essere visualizzata una finestra del browser per consentire l'inserimento delle credenziali. Se questo script è destinato a essere eseguito in un ambiente automatizzato/senza supervisione, questo parametro deve essere impostato su False.

Valore restituito

Testo |